Job Description

The Activity Manager reports to the Center Director and will be responsible for organizing off-site excursions and on-campus activity programs, ensuring their successful implementation by supervising and supporting a team of activity counselors. In addition to the duties related to the excursion program, you will be engaged in residential and administrative duties to ensure the smooth running of the camp.

Your key tasks will consist of but not be limited to:

Excursions and Activities

Preparation:

  • Make new bookings to excursion sites, confirm or make changes to existing bookings.
  • Plan on-campus activities, supervise staff/students, and ensure student satisfaction.
  • Prepare weekly excursion schedules and daily itineraries and deliver them to Activity Leaders in advance.
  • Make changes to excursion schedules according to staff strengths/weaknesses/experience/preferences, the weather, and client feedback.
  • Supervise staff in preparing for excursions/activities (information/directions/files and backpacks/meal arrangements, etc.).
  • Ensure all participants have credit cards available for off-campus dinners, if applicable.
  • Supervise departures for excursions and solve any problems.
  • Keep students/chaperones updated on their excursion program/time/meeting points, etc.

During Excursions/Activities:

  • Monitor and frequently check in with staff to make sure they are following the approved itinerary.
  • Respond promptly to staff and chaperones. Solve problems or emergencies that arise during excursions.
  • Liaise between Activity Leaders and chaperones if any disagreements arise.

After Excursions:

  • Seek feedback from excursion and activity counselors.
  • Check out staff for the day (collect pictures and videos, travel cards, receipts, credit cards, and change).

Team Support and Supervision:

  • With the help of the Center Director, review, edit, and update the YES USA current Operations Manual for excursion staff with sufficient details.
  • Lead training sessions for the excursion team.
  • Run regular staff meetings to provide up-to-date excursion information.
  • Supervise, guide, and monitor staff.
  • Evaluate staff performance and report ongoing findings to the Center Director daily.
  • Create a positive atmosphere and motivate effectively, offering praise and recognition whenever possible.
  • Establish and maintain team discipline.
  • Supervise admin staff and evaluate their performance related to the excursion program and excursion meals.

Student Supervision:

  • Act in loco parentis to ensure and maintain student discipline, welfare, safety, and security whenever in contact with students.
  • Ensure that the YES USA team maintains appropriate standards of student supervision both during excursions and on campus.
  • Program Quality Control and Customer Service
  • Ensure the quality and high standards of the excursion and activity program by regularly observing and taking part.
  • Review and suggest improvements to the current excursion program.
  • Ensure a high level of customer satisfaction with the daily excursion and activity program.
  • Collect feedback (including informal) from students and chaperones and follow up on it to ensure their happiness.
  • Conduct daily meetings with chaperones (respond to their questions, address changes to the program, etc.) and ensure their satisfaction.

Hours:

This role requires a high level of flexibility and availability throughout the camp to respond to the dynamic demands of our program. Hours may be varied and intensive, reflecting the needs of the camp schedule. While one day off per week is offered, it will be coordinated with the center director based on the excursions/activities calendar, ensuring availability on busier days.

Weekly commitment: 60 hours.

Compensation and Benefits:

  • Housing in a single room in a shared university dorm is provided during the camp.
  • $1,330 - $1,530 per week (housing provided)
